Module microsoft

Module microsoft 

Source
Expand description

Microsoft OAuth 2.0 authentication for Minecraft

Implements the Device Code Flow for authenticating Minecraft accounts via Microsoft. This is a multi-step process:

  1. Request a device code
  2. User authorizes via browser
  3. Poll for token
  4. Exchange for Xbox Live token
  5. Exchange for XSTS token
  6. Exchange for Minecraft token
  7. Fetch Minecraft profile

Structsยง

MicrosoftAuth
Microsoft authenticator using Device Code Flow